Поделиться через


XmlMap Интерфейс

Определение

Представляет XML-карту, добавленную в книгу.

public interface class XmlMap
[System.Runtime.InteropServices.Guid("0002447B-0000-0000-C000-000000000046")]
[System.Runtime.InteropServices.InterfaceType(2)]
public interface XmlMap
Public Interface XmlMap
Атрибуты

Комментарии

Функции XML, за исключением сохранения файлов в формате ЭЛЕКТРОННОЙ таблицы XML, доступны только в Microsoft Office профессиональный Edition 2003 и Microsoft Office Excel 2003.

Add(String, Object) Используйте метод коллекции, XmlMaps чтобы добавить XML-карту в книгу.

Импорт и экспорт XML-данных

Используйте метод для импорта Import(String, Object) XML-данных из XML-файла данных в ячейки, сопоставленные с указанным XmlMap. Метод ImportXml(String, Object) импортирует XML-данные для переменной String .

Используйте метод для Export(String, Object) экспорта данных из ячеек, сопоставленных с указанным XmlMap. Метод ExportXml(String) экспортирует XML-данные в переменную String .

Свойства

_Default

Представляет XML-карту, добавленную в книгу.

AdjustColumnWidth

Значение true , если ширина столбцов автоматически настраивается для оптимального соответствия при каждом обновлении указанной таблицы запросов или XML-карты. Значение false , если ширина столбцов не настраивается автоматически при каждом обновлении. Значение по умолчанию — True. Для чтения и записи, Boolean.

AppendOnImport

Значение true , если вы хотите добавить новые строки в списки XML, привязанные к указанной схеме при импорте новых данных или обновлении существующего подключения. Значение False , если требуется перезаписать содержимое ячеек. Значение по умолчанию — False. Для чтения и записи, Boolean.

Application

Application Возвращает объект , представляющий приложение Microsoft Excel. Только для чтения.

Creator

Возвращает 32-битное целое число, указывающее на приложение, в котором объект был создан. Если объект был создан в Microsoft Excel, это свойство возвращает строку XCEL, эквивалентную шестнадцатеричной цифре 5843454C. Только для XlCreatorчтения .

DataBinding

XmlDataBinding Возвращает объект , представляющий привязку, связанную с указанной схемой. Только для чтения.

IsExportable

Возвращает значение True , если Microsoft Excel может использовать XPath объекты в указанной схеме для экспорта XML-данных и если все XML-списки, сопоставленные с указанной схемой, можно экспортировать. Только для чтения, Boolean.

Name

Возвращает или задает понятное имя, используемое для уникальной идентификации сопоставления в книге. Для чтения и записи, String.

Parent

Возвращает родительский объект для указанного объекта. Только для чтения.

PreserveColumnFilter

Возвращает или задает значение, указывающее, сохраняется ли фильтрация при обновлении указанной карты XML. Для чтения и записи, Boolean.

PreserveNumberFormatting

Значение true, если форматирование чисел в ячейках, сопоставленных с указанной схемой XML, будет сохранено при обновлении схемы. Значение по умолчанию — False. Для чтения и записи, Boolean.

RootElementName

Возвращает значение String , представляющее имя корневого элемента для указанной схемы XML. Только для чтения.

RootElementNamespace

XmlNamespace Возвращает объект , представляющий корневой элемент для указанной схемы XML. Только для чтения.

SaveDataSourceDefinition

Значение true , если определение источника данных указанной схемы XML сохраняется вместе с книгой. Значение по умолчанию — True. Для чтения и записи, Boolean.

Schemas

Возвращает коллекцию XmlSchemas , представляющую схемы, содержащиеся в указанном XmlMap объекте. Только для чтения.

ShowImportExportValidationErrors

Возвращает или задает, будет ли отображаться диалоговое окно с подробными сведениями об ошибках проверки схемы при импорте или экспорте данных с помощью указанной схемы XML. Значение по умолчанию — False. Для чтения и записи, Boolean.

WorkbookConnection

Перенастройка нового соединения для указанного XmlMap объекта. Только для чтения.

Методы

Delete()

Удаляет указанную xml-карту из книги.

Export(String, Object)

Экспортирует содержимое ячеек, сопоставленных указанному XmlMap объекту, в XML-файл данных. Возвращает .XlXmlExportResult

ExportXml(String)

Экспортирует содержимое ячеек, сопоставленных с указанным XmlMap объектом, в переменную String . Возвращает .XlXmlExportResult

Import(String, Object)

Импортирует данные из указанного XML-файла данных в ячейки, сопоставленные с указанным XmlMap объектом. Возвращает .XlXmlImportResult

ImportXml(String, Object)

Импортирует XML-данные из переменной String в ячейки, сопоставленные с указанным XmlMap объектом. Возвращает константу XlXmlImportResult .

Применяется к